Cracking the Code: Understanding How Open-Source Tools Extract SEO Data (And Why You Should Care)
Open-source tools have emerged as powerful allies for SEO professionals, offering transparent and customizable approaches to data extraction that proprietary solutions often lack. Unlike their closed-source counterparts, these tools are built on publicly accessible codebases, allowing developers and SEOs alike to understand exactly how data is being collected, processed, and presented. This transparency fosters a level of trust and adaptability that's crucial in the ever-evolving SEO landscape. Consider the implications for crawling and data parsing: with open-source solutions, you're not beholden to a vendor's pre-defined parameters. Instead, you can:
- Tailor extraction rules for highly specific data points.
- Integrate with other systems seamlessly due to open APIs.
- Audit the code to ensure data integrity and avoid 'black box' issues.
This level of control empowers you to extract the precise SEO data you need, fostering more accurate analysis and ultimately, more effective strategies.
But why should you, as an SEO-focused content creator, genuinely care about the mechanics of how open-source tools extract data? The answer lies in the strategic advantage it provides. Understanding the underlying processes allows you to move beyond simply accepting data at face value. Instead, you can critically evaluate the information, identify potential biases or limitations, and even contribute to the tool's improvement. This deeper comprehension empowers you to:
"Leverage open-source tools not just as data providers, but as flexible frameworks for bespoke SEO intelligence."
Imagine needing to track highly niche competitor data or analyze specific on-page elements in an unconventional way. Proprietary tools might offer limited customization, but with an open-source solution like a custom Python crawler, you can script the exact data points you require. This ability to 'look under the hood' translates directly into better decision-making, helping you uncover unique insights and develop content strategies that truly stand out in a crowded digital space.
When seeking alternatives to the Semrush API, several powerful options cater to various needs and budgets. These Semrush API alternatives often provide similar functionalities, such as keyword research, backlink analysis, site audits, and competitor analysis, but may differ in terms of data coverage, API call limits, pricing models, and specific feature sets.
Your Open-Source Toolkit: Practical Strategies for Extracting Keyword, Backlink, and SERP Data (Plus FAQs)
Navigating the vast landscape of SEO data doesn't always require a hefty budget. Your open-source toolkit offers surprisingly robust capabilities for unearthing valuable insights into keywords, backlinks, and SERP dynamics. Think beyond just Google Keyword Planner alternatives; tools like Open-source web scrapers (e.g., Scrapy, BeautifulSoup in Python) allow you to custom-extract specific data points directly from competitor websites or SERP results, giving you granular control over the information you gather. Combine this with command-line tools for analyzing text files, and you can quickly identify common keyword phrases, analyze competitor page structures, or even monitor subtle shifts in SERP features. The key here is not just knowing *what* tools exist, but understanding the practical strategies for combining them to create a powerful, customized data extraction pipeline tailored to your unique SEO objectives.
Practical application of these open-source resources hinges on a strategic approach. For keyword research, consider scraping Google's 'People Also Ask' sections or 'Related Searches' to uncover long-tail opportunities that commercial tools might miss. For backlink analysis, while you won't get a complete index like Ahrefs, you can use tools like Common Crawl or even simple Python scripts to identify external links pointing to your competitors' high-ranking pages, giving you initial outreach targets. SERP data extraction becomes particularly powerful when you track specific queries over time, noting changes in featured snippets, local packs, or image carousels. This allows for agile adjustments to your content strategy, ensuring you're always optimizing for the current search landscape. Remember, the power lies in your ability to combine these accessible tools with a clear understanding of your data needs and a willingness to get a little hands-on.
